What does APBL0003013 mean?

APBL0003013
APBL — Bank code. Identifies Andhra Pradesh State Co-operative Bank. All branches of Andhra Pradesh State Co-operative Bank share this prefix.
0 — Reserved character. Always zero in every IFSC code in India.
003013 — Branch code. Uniquely identifies the M V P COLONY BRANCH branch within Andhra Pradesh State Co-operative Bank.
